According to Alfred M. Szmidt on 10/2/2005 5:39 AM:
> Anyway, this is already documented in the info manual:
>
> ,----[ (coreutils)dircolors invocation ]
> | 10.4 `dircolors': Color setup for `ls'
> | ======================================
> |
> | `dircolors' outputs a sequence of shell commands to set up the terminal
> | for color output from `ls' (and `dir', etc.). Typical usage:
> |
> | eval `dircolors [OPTION]... [FILE]`
Actually, in 5.90, the documentation recommends
eval "`dircolors [OPTION]... [FILE]`"
to combat against specially named files causing a mild security hole.
